Medicare and your private health insurance provider will just pay you for a portion of the rhinoplasty procedure that is executed to correct breathing (functional surgery). It is not possible that they'll cover any part done to improve your look (cosmetic surgery).

It's up to every patient to contact their health finance to learn what they're going to cover, but, if it's determined that you have a functional problem; we'll assist you obtain agreement of coverage from your insurance company. Your hospital expenses could be also paid by your personal health finance, based on your plan.

A rhinoplasty, colloquially known as a nose job, is a surgical process to adjust the way the nose appears cosmetically. It's performed to make the nose bigger or smaller, change the direction, get rid of a lump or indentation or modify the nose tip. A rhinoplasty is also executed to fix a birth deformity or structural issues which trigger congestion and breathing troubles. Lastly, the method might be performed in cases of distressing damage leading to disability.

A lot of rhinoplasty surgery applicants are individuals who are not delighted with their nose’s size or shape. No matter what your choice is when it comes to undergoing a nose job, it is still a subjective decision to be made together with the help of a plastic surgeon’s expert guidance.

The Rhinoplasty Procedure

With regards to your rhinoplasty operation, it's anticipated that you'll first have a full and private examination together with the surgeon.  You will be briefed with the most feasible and practical outcomes for your nose job. This is also a chance that you know more regarding your surgeon. You may ask to check out his previous works where he will voluntarily show you before and after photographs.

During the examination discuss in detail the surgeon’s ideas with regards to the situation of your existing nose and the approaches that could be carried out to attain your required result. Do not be afraid to obtain another opinion if you think this is necessary. Don't forget it is your nose we're treating, and you alone know if you feel secure with the procedures outlined. If you are presented a paper to approve with all the risks revealed study it properly before putting your signature on. Make sure you and the surgeon are on the “same page” as to what you wish.

Your rhinoplasty treatment is going to be performed under a kind of general anaesthesia called twilight anaesthesia, which means that you'll be sedated, although not unconscious, for the entire period of the procedure and you will feel no pain. The entire process will take about 2-4 hours to perform. After the surgery assume that you will feel swelling on your nose. There is typically little soreness, but you might feel a sensation firmness and pressure on your nose because of the inflammation. You might also encounter profuse nasal bleeding.

Cost of Rhinoplasty Procedures and Insurance Cover

The expenses of cosmetic surgeries of the nose differ widely. The price may show the quality of the surgeon, but usually it is the type of procedure that states price. In checking plastic surgeons in Kirribilli we find the cost may deviate from $6,500 to $14,000 - commonly at the entry level for a day-stay rhinoplasty plus the high end for an overnight-stay treatment, though this may differ.

Normally, insurance, private or government, doesn't cover cosmetic surgery such as rhinoplasty. Some reconstruction of cosmetic disorders following an accident could be covered within particular plans, and repair of certain congenital issues are often covered too. There also may be limited coverage available for any portion of an operation that is not considered cosmetic like a deviated septum.

On the other hand, the portion of the surgery that seeks to fix aesthetic areas of the appearance of the nose would not be covered. It is advisable to talk about your procedure with the surgeon as well as insurance company should you feel any portion might be included.
